neel06
hello friends. I will be sending documents to my husband this week. I am not sure what service to use. any suggestions on which is the most reliable.

by the way he lives in a village... about 1 hour away from a major city.

thanks.
ELW
USPS is best because it is pretty much reliable and cheapest; however it may take 7-10 days or longer to get there. It is really about your only choice because courier will probably not deliver to the village. I sent most things by USPS but sent a few important original documents via FedEx (guaranteed safe and arrives within 3 days usually). In case you are paranoid about some important original documents (like I was!) you can contact a friend or relative in a major city and send via FedEx or DHL, then they can hand deliver to your husband.

JanaknJanet
Living in Portland Or.. I have tried Fedex UPS and USPS...
Today actually I sent Jan a packet of documents... Set 5 arrival on Sept 10 ..weight was .41 oz cost of document mailing to Gujurat.. $51 ...
FEDEX quoted me $75.. and would get there Sept 13.
DHL quoted $55 and states could get there in 3 days but would not give a date.. and would add another fee to pick up .. and couldn't guarantee that the pick up was going to happen today ..

Jan sent me a package DTDC service weight of 12 lbs.. from Gujarat took it to service on the 23 of Aug where it sat till Aug 30.. it FINALLY arrived in NEW YORK Sept 4.. sat there again.. and this morning I found out that the AIR service that was paid for was not transfered here in USA and the package got transfered to UPS GROUND... NOOWWW the package that was due last friday is now not going to arrive until SEPT 11.... go figure..
seems someone on some side mixed up the tracking and it got put on the wrong system of ground instead of AIR... UPS at least is going to try and track it to see if it was their error or if it was DTDC and see if they can catch it in Illinois and get it on a plane sooner than surface travel.. When I talked to DTDC office in New York.. all i got was the runaround.. of.. the package was sent .. call this XXX number.. (which was not a working number) so thank goodness for UPS supervisor to do what she can to help me.. ..
